- Provide hands‑on Physical Therapy interventions under the direction of a supervising therapist
- Implement established Physical Therapy treatment plans for pediatric patients
- Support children in improving mobility, balance, coordination, and functional independence
- Assist with therapeutic exercises and activities that promote development and strength
- Educate families and caregivers on home exercise programs and carryover
- Monitor and report patient progress to supervising therapist
- Coordinate care with the clinical team
- Document all Physical Therapy services in an electronic medical record system
- Maintain compliance with all clinical and regulatory standards
